Hydrogen Power: Promises, Pitfalls, and The Path Forward
Hydrogen power presents as a potential solution in the quest for clean energy. Its abundance and green nature make it an promising alternative to fossil fuels. However, significant hurdles remain in its widespread adoption. The production of hydrogen often relies on fossil fuel-based processes, raising concerns about its overall sustainability. Furthermore, the network required to distribute hydrogen is currently sparse, posing logistical challenges. Despite these drawbacks, ongoing innovation in areas such as renewable hydrogen production and storage technologies holds promise for a more eco-friendly energy future.

Green Energy's Next Frontier: Evaluating the Hydrogen Switch
Green energy has advanced at a rapid pace, with numerous emerging technologies vying for prominence. Among these, hydrogen generation has emerged as a potential contender, offering a clean alternative to fossil fuels. However, before we completely adopt this new power solution, it is crucial to carefully assess its feasibility.
Several factors need careful consideration. First, the manufacturing of hydrogen itself can be demanding, depending on the process employed. Green hydrogen, produced from renewable energy sources, presents a more sustainable option but requires significant investment.
Furthermore, the network required to distribute hydrogen effectively across long distances is currently underdeveloped. Regulation of production and storage protocols is also essential to maintain security throughout the distribution system.
Finally, market penetration will play a pivotal part in determining the efficacy of hydrogen as a mainstream power solution. Public awareness regarding its advantages, as well as risks, will shape consumer behavior.
